Resumen

The aim of this Memorandum is to solidify bilateral cooperation for the development of veterinary health care services, reduce the spread of diseases and the development of preventive vaccine industry. This Memorandum is composed of 9 articles. Articles 1 to 5 define fields of cooperation between Parties in particular: laying down engineering studies for the production of foot-and-mouth disease vaccine; training of Syrian technicians on the production of vaccine and quality control; to send Iranian experts to start the production and training of Syrian cadres; study costs of the project and agree on the funding mechanism; exchange requirements for the registration of veterinary medicines and vaccines; research and implementation of joint projects in the field of animal diseases; and, the provision of laboratory equipment for diagnosis. Articles 6 to 9 contain general provisions.
